
Senior Mobile Software Engineer
- Leiria
- Permanente
- Horário completo
- Design and develop Flutter-based mobile apps for Android and iOS.
- Build custom packages in Flutter using the functionalities and APIs already available in native Android and iOS.
- Test Flutter components on multiple form factors and platforms, from mobile to web.
- Actively participate in the full software development lifecycle alongside teammates.
- Collaborate with design, product, and backend teams to translate user stories into technical solutions.
- Implement CI/CD pipelines, unit testing, and performance monitoring tools.
- Review, identify, and fix code errors and performance issues.
- Work independently and use creativity to develop new Flutter solutions.
- Ensure products conform to high industry standards.
- Guide junior and mid-level engineers through best practices, code structure, and problem-solving techniques.
- Stay current with Flutter/Dart best practices and ecosystem trends.
- BSc/MSc degree in Computer Science, Computer Engineering, or a similar field.
- 1+ years of experience designing and building sophisticated and highly scalable apps using Flutter and Dart.
- Knowledge of scripting, session management, and mobile UI/UX development.
- Experience integrating native modules and platform channels.
- Experience with Flutter test frameworks (e.g., Patrol) is valued.
- Unity knowledge is valued.
- GraphQL knowledge is valued.
- Familiarity with Git/GitLab and CI/CD tools (e.g., Fastlane).
- Experience with performance, memory, and space optimization.
- Good communication skills.
- Good troubleshooting skills.
- Excellent attention to detail.
- Relaxed Culture & Flat Hierarchy: We foster an open and collaborative environment
- 25 Vacation Days: including a special day off to celebrate your birthday, an extra day around Christmas and New Year’s
- Stock Options: Own a piece of our success
- Health, dental and vision insurance: Comprehensive coverage starting after one year
- Meal Allowance
- Learning & Development: 5 exclusive days per year for company-paid training and company library with a selection of technical books
- Team Buildings: Regular events to strengthen our community including an annual hackathon (with rewards)
- Flexible holidays and working hours
- Hybrid work (we require new hires to spend at least 3 full days per week in the office)
- Free coffee and refreshments in our offices
- Your preferred IT setup (Mac or PC) and any required devices for your work (e.g., test smartphones)
- Work on the latest tech stacks and trends
- Home Office Setup: We'll provide what you need to work comfortably from home
- Annual Bonus: Receive up to two additional salaries each year
- Referral Program: Earn €250 for every successful referral